World Bank [WB]

Is one of five institutions created at the Bretton Woods Conference in 1944, and provides loans to developing countries for capital programs. (source: http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/World_Bank)

United Nations Development Program [UNDP]

The UN’s global development network, advocating for change and connecting countries to knowledge, experience and resources to help people build a better life. (source: http://www.undp.org/content/undp/en/home/operations/about_us/frequently_askedquestions/#undp)
